Transaction fe8423170a19004665fbbd78396887159c6402e0acc559aa9af1a00dcea32555
1 Input
1 Output
-
fe8423170a19004665fbbd78396887159c6402e0acc559aa9af1a00dcea32555:0
- value
- 514828
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b289454d81fd03dcafe17fe0c04e2975da7c8dc
- address
- bc1q8v5fg4xcrlgrmjh7zllqcp8zjaw60jxu2gj3cu